Use of Asphalt Modified with Waste Material as the Tack Coat on the Interface between the Binder and Wearing Courses

Asphalt pavement consists of multiple courses, and a tack coat between the courses to ensure that these courses are properly bonded to each other is used. Generally, asphalt binder, asphalt emulsion, and cutback asphalt as the tack coat to ensure the bonding between the pavement courses are used. For the first time, to the best of our knowledge, in this study, the use of asphalts modified with bio-oil obtained from pyrolysis of waste recycled polypropylene in granular form as the tack coat on the interface between binder and wearing courses in laboratory conditions was examined. In order to evaluate the performance of double-layered asphalt samples containing a tack coat, strengths after the freeze-thaw test the indirect tensile strength (ITS), tensile strength ratio (TSR), and interfacial bond strengths of double-layered asphalt samples were calculated. Also, this study examined the influence of different factors [tack coat type (50/70 asphalt and asphalts modified with PPB at ratios of 1%, 2%, and 3%), application ratios (0.15, 0.30, and 0.50 L/m2), and cleanliness conditions of binder course] on the performance double-layered asphalt samples containing tack coat. Results indicate that the double-layered asphalt samples containing asphalt modified with PPB at a ratio of 2% at an optimum application ratio of 0.30 L/m2 a tack coat have the highest ITSdry value and interfacial bond strength, the ITSwet and TSR values of double-layered asphalt samples decreased as the number of freeze-thaw cycles increased, and the tack coat material, application ratios, and cleanliness conditions are affected ITS, TSR, and interfacial bond strengths of double-layered asphalt samples containing tack coat.
